Job Description

As a Data Engineer within MassMutual’s Corporate Technology Data Engineering & Analytics team in Boston, MA on a hybrid schedule, you will help design and implement ELT pipelines, data marts, and data warehouse solutions to support Investment Management. You will work closely with analysts, architects, and business stakeholders to translate requirements into scalable data solutions.

Responsibilities

  • Design, build, and assess intricate ELT workflows that consolidate diverse data sources into high-integrity, reliable data assets.
  • Contribute to data modeling policies, procedures, and standards, providing actionable feedback.
  • Capture and document system flows and other technical details about data, database design, and related systems.
  • Establish comprehensive data quality standards and implement effective tools to ensure data accuracy and reliability.
  • Collaborate with Investment Management teams to understand new data patterns and requirements.
  • Work with Data Analysts, Data Architects, and BI developers to deliver scalable data solutions aligned with business goals.
  • Translate high level business requirements into detailed technical specifications.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Systems or a related technical field.
  • Eight or more years of experience in data analytics, data modeling, and database design.
  • Five or more years of experience with ELT methodologies and tools.
  • Five or more years of experience in designing, developing, tuning, and troubleshooting SQL.
  • Three or more years of coding and scripting experience in Python, Java, or Scala, including design work.
  • Two or more years of experience with the Spark framework.
